Why variance still matters at these rates Even with an SIR rate of ~1 in 71, the variance in any single session is significant: Opening one booster box (36 packs) gives roughly a 40% chance of pulling an SIR meaning most single-box sessions end with zero Print run batching means SIRs can cluster into specific cases, leaving adjacent cases dry The 500-pack opening pulled 7 SIRs but distribution across individual boxes within that 500 would not be uniform Small samples (12 boxes) are too small to draw conclusions about personal luck or set rates Chasing a specific SIR: the real odds Total SIRs in set: 11 (7 Pokmon SIRs + 4 Trainer SIRs) Avg packs per any SIR: ~71 Avg packs per specific SIR: ~781 At 36 packs per booster box, that is roughly 22 booster boxes per specific SIR on average Verdict: For a specific card, buy the single
